Maize vegetation received a few foliar apps of each modulator, and saccharification was assessed in various plant organs. Neither treatment method influenced plant morphology, expansion, or biomass efficiency. Equally modulators appreciably enhanced biomass saccharification throughout multiple plant organs, with gains starting from 31% to seventy two%. For entire-plant biomass, PIP elevated saccharification by sixty two% and seventy four% soon after single and double apps, respectively, Whilst MDCA improved saccharification by forty two% and 76%. Despite the fact that both compounds ended up effective, PIP showed a dependable efficiency next just one very low-dose software. These outcomes exhibit the opportunity of lignin biosynthesis modulators to further improve maize biomass digestibility with out compromising agronomic effectiveness, supporting their use as a possible technique to improve forage top quality and livestock generation performance. Above two decades, distinct Organic and built-in Manage methods ended up compared with traditional courses depending on synthetic anti-downy mildew fungicides. In general, the outcomes highlighted the value of: (i) a preventive solution, involving early-season applications targeting Principal inoculum and First bacterial infections; and (ii) an built-in strategy, combining distinct anti-downy mildew formulations with a number of modes of motion. Throughout two yrs of industry trials, the best reduction in sickness incidence was achieved with integrated Manage techniques through which the bioformulate YSY®, based upon the effective yeast PT22AV, was used early during the time, together with other industrial formulations determined by copper and plant extracts. Perinatal pressure induces Professional-inflammatory cytokine secretion, activates the intestinal JAK-STAT3 pathway, and upregulates intestinal hepcidin expression, impairing intestinal barrier integrity and triggering persistent inflammation. These peripheral inflammatory alerts modulate hypothalamic neuropeptide Y and Proopiomelanocortin expression, forming a negative comments loop that suppresses feeding habits. (two) Nutritional regulation: dietary nutrients and precise taste compounds reshape intestinal satiety signaling, improving piglet development efficiency and survival costs, when optimized dietary composition and purposeful additive supplementation enhance sow feed consumption ability. (3) Management methods: standardized feeding regimes and ideal rearing environments regulate nutrient digestion and gut hormone secretion. Major knowledge gaps consist of the translational possible of precision nutrition strategies, biomarker validation for feed ingestion monitoring, as well as the scalability of integrated interventions under professional generation ailments. This critique supplies a multidimensional framework integrating physiological, nutritional, and management strategies to improve sow feed consumption, go here providing theoretical insights and practical steerage for sustainable pig creation. The reproductive efficiency of recent breeding sows is often restricted by a mismatch concerning significant genetic reproductive likely and insufficient voluntary feed ingestion through essential physiological periods. This evaluate comprehensively examines the physiological, nutritional, and management mechanisms regulating feed ingestion in sows and their implications for reproductive overall performance, synthesizing recent advancements across neuroendocrine regulation, metabolic signaling, immune-linked pathways, and precision feeding techniques. We assemble an integrated framework involving a few core Proportions: (one) Physiological regulation: the hypothalamic–pituitary–adrenal, hypothalamic–pituitary–gonadal, and hypothalamic–pituitary–spleen axes functionally interact through shared neuroimmune pathways throughout the hypothalamic–pituitary–immune axis, coordinately regulating feeding designs and reproductive cyclicity through core hormonal and inflammatory signaling molecules.

Plasmopara viticola, the causal agent of grapevine downy mildew, is among The key pathogens affecting vineyards throughout the world. In Italy, the 2023 rising time was Amongst the most important in recent years, with serious downy mildew outbreaks favored by exceptionally conducive climatic situations. Suitable management minimizes produce losses and decreases reliance on synthetic and copper-primarily based fungicides, thereby mitigating hazards for your environment and buyer overall health. Our research aimed to produce a powerful and sustainable Organic Handle method depending on the application of the effective microorganism coupled with natural compounds, even though lessening copper inputs.

Increasing forage biomass utilization is a vital strategy for expanding the effectiveness of ruminant production devices. Lignin limitations the accessibility of structural polysaccharides to hydrolytic enzymes, lessening biomass deconstruction and nutrient utilization. Modulation of lignin biosynthesis for the duration of plant improvement has emerged to be a promising approach to minimize cell wall recalcitrance and strengthen biomass digestibility. On this analyze, we evaluated the effects of two lignin biosynthesis modulators, piperonylic acid (PIP) and methylenedioxy cinnamic acid (MDCA), on maize biomass saccharification and plant enhancement below subject circumstances.
